A "turkey shoot" is a term that originated from a shooting contest in which participants were given the task of shooting turkeys. However, over time, the phrase has taken on a more general meaning that refers to an incredibly easy or effortless task. Some synonyms for "turkey shoot" include "piece of cake," "cakewalk," "walkover," "blowout," and "slaughter." These phrases are used to describe a situation where one team or individual achieves an easy victory over their opponents without much effort.
